  • More about product

    Thenics earns its reputation as a contender for the best app for calisthenics by focusing exclusively on the high-level skills popularized by Street Workout and CrossFit. At the heart of this approach is its progression system, which we found to be its standout feature. By systematically breaking down fundamental skills like the muscle-up and planche into distinct workouts, it provides a clear, step-by-step path based on your current ability, effectively removing the guesswork from achieving complex movements.

    This entire progression is supported by a well-structured content library. It guides you on a complete journey, starting with the basic skills needed to build a strong foundation and progressing all the way to advanced "pro skills" like the one-arm pull-up and human flag. To manage this progression, the app offers the 'Thenics Coach', an intelligent tool we found particularly helpful. It addresses common training questions, generating a personalized plan that makes each calisthenics workout more targeted and effective.

    Calistree's primary strength is what makes it one of the contenders for the best free app for calisthenics: its massive exercise library. It offers clear instructional videos for over 1500 exercises, providing a comprehensive and completely free resource for learning and perfecting your technique.
  • More about product

    The app’s primary intelligence lies in its adaptability; it excels at generating personalized programs from this vast library of 1500+ exercises that perfectly match your environment, whether you're at home with minimal gear or in a fully equipped gym.

    We found the level of workout modification to be particularly robust, moving beyond just selecting equipment. You can fine-tune any exercise by adding weight, elastic bands, or adjusting specific RPE (Rate of Perceived Exertion) settings. This helps you by creating a program that is truly bespoke to your exact circumstances and capabilities.

    This highly customized training isn't random; it's guided by a logical progression system. The app uses a visual 'skill tree' to provide clear advancement paths, ensuring you develop skills safely and effectively. This entire journey is then monitored by a detailed progress tracker that utilizes personal records, mastery levels, and experience points to provide a comprehensive view of your development.

    Progressive Workouts builds your strength systematically using sports science principles and expert trainer guidance, giving you confidence that each exercise serves a specific purpose in your development.
  • More about product

    When evaluating the best calisthenics app for structured progression, this one stands out with its focused, evidence-based approach to bodyweight strength training. We found the programming refreshingly straightforward—it's built by experienced trainers, keeping the focus squarely on building strength through bodyweight exercises. With proper nutrition alongside the training, you'll likely see both muscle gain and fat loss as you progress.

    We particularly appreciated the structured three-times-per-week schedule with mandatory rest days, since recovery often gets overlooked in fitness apps. Your journey starts with fundamental movements like pull-ups, push-ups, and squats, then systematically advances toward complex skills like planche, one-arm chin-ups, and pistol squats. We liked how clear and motivating the advancement criteria felt—once you hit three sets of eight reps or three sets of 30-second holds, you unlock the next level, creating a satisfying sense of achievement with each progression.

    Progressive Workouts encourages you to beat your previous numbers each session, which creates measurable advancement that keeps motivation high. We found the statistics and workout history features particularly helpful for tracking long-term development and identifying patterns in the training. The app works well for home training, though you'll need basic pulling equipment like a doorway pull-up bar or gymnastic rings for the complete experience.
